<h1>Supreme Court dismissed appeals due to nominal tax effect, leaving the question of law open.</h1> Supreme Court dismissed appeals due to nominal tax effect, leaving the question of law open. - 2016 (338) E.L.T. A232 (SC) Valuation - MRP based valuation - Rental charges on bottles and crates - the decision in the case of HINDUSTAN COCA-COLA BEVERAGES P. LTD. Versus COMMR. OF C. EX., ALLAHABAD [2006 (3) TMI 392 - CESTAT, NEW DELHI] contested - Held that: - tax effect is nominal. Therefore, the appeals are dismissed on this ground. The question of law is left open.
